In addition to not having "that guy" on the field (or the locker room) last season, the WR corps across the board failed to produce, as evidenced by four of them transferring since — AHC/WR coach Holmon Wiggins has stated as much.
There were also various additional reasons as mentioned herein, but in that offense, the significance of not having a Julio Jones, Amari Cooper, Calvin Ridley, Jerry Jeudy, Henry Ruggs, Jaylen Waddle, DeVonta Smith, or even a Jameson Williams cannot be overstated.
